- [ ] Step 7: Archive cold storage buckets (Glacierline tier). Confirm both ceremony witnesses are present, verify bucket manifests match the Oxbow ledger, then seal the archive key shares. Plugin authors may observe but not handle shares. Once sealed, the archive index itself is encrypted and can only be reopened with the passphrase below.

vault phrase of badup-hahig = tamael-aldael-kelmir-istael-fenok-istwyn-tamius-jorath-oliion

**Q: Why do we pin every dependency in Lanternworks repos, even tiny ones?**

Short answer: because the Great Marmoset Incident of last spring taught us that "latest" is a lie. All builds in the Perrow pipeline resolve from the lockfile, full stop. If you need to bump something, update the pin and re-run the audit job. Oh, and if the audit vault prompts you during a pin migration, the recovery passphrase you'll need is right below.

vault phrase of tajeg-tageg = pelix-druix-holius-briael-zorwyn-frawyn-fraox-norok-drueth-aldiel

Subject: Health checks flapping behind the Larkspur LB

Team — the Quillway API pods are intermittently failing the /healthz probe behind the Larkspur load balancer. Probe timeout is 2s; cold JIT paths occasionally exceed it after deploys. We've bumped the timeout to 5s and added a warmup endpoint. On-call: watch the ejection count for the next hour. The build that carries the fix is identified below.

build token for tawip-yageg: htk9_92ac43d42

**Mgmt Meeting Minutes — Retiring the Brightline Range**

Quick recap for sales leads at Fenholt Supplies: we agreed to retire the Brightline fixture range by year-end. Remaining stock moves to clearance pricing next month, and accounts on standing orders get migrated to the Lumetta range. Trade-in incentives were approved in principle. The confidential note on next steps sits just below.

board note of bajof-bajeg: The pricing group signed off on a budget of $13.4 million for Project Sildor. The renewal with Lamixek Holdings closes at $48.9 million a year, 49 percent above the last contract.